Overview

The Specialty Resource Coordinator provides independent and high-level support to Physicians and Advance Care Practitioner to maximize provider efficiency increase patient satisfaction and maximize patient access. Responsible for coordinating and adjusting resources daily for all practice providers covering all practice offices and hospitals.

Responsible for coordinating cases and consultations autonomously understanding specialty complexities and provider expertise while navigating the interdependence of various institutions. Interprets and manages intricate call schedules across multiple locations effectively communicating with all stakeholders. Quickly adapts and reallocates resources to meet changing needs ensuring decisions support provider productivity and operational efficiency. Proactively organizes work and tracks outcomes to detect or prevent issues. Executes schedules with precision and utilizes knowledge of medical terminology effectively.
